Transaction f99a7801699dd566c3db08221a2b9a172cd95687c119cb5a935029868605041c

1 Input
2 Outputs
  • f99a7801699dd566c3db08221a2b9a172cd95687c119cb5a935029868605041c:0
  • value  3941553
    address  1HESZPTjVYtMuqVk3ZbyBbJRHvR5ry2FVx
  • f99a7801699dd566c3db08221a2b9a172cd95687c119cb5a935029868605041c:1
  • value  5921
    address  3QkGnvRt7Crxg4kdR5riDEM9pMTibwfBQD